For simultaneous digital & analog audio output
In some instances, a user may want to hear 5.1 surround sound in his/her theater from the SPDIF out of a audio-video source, but
also wants distribute this source through the rest of the house through their multiroom audio system. However, many set-top boxes and
media centers have DRM limitations where only 1 type of audio output - a choice of either HDMI, digital/SPDIF, or analog - can be active at any given time (i.e. there are no simultaneous outputs). Thus, simply connecting the cables to the different outputs would not permit this to work.
This "SPDIF DAC & Splitting Kit" is the answer! Simply connect the source's optical or coaxial SPDIF output, split it, and have 1 digital output (optical or coaxial) go into the surround sound receiver, and the other output would be fed into the SPDIF DAC. This DAC will then actively convert the digital audio signal directly into 2.0 analog, allowing you to enjoy both 5.1 and 2.0 audio simultaneously!

DAC Technical Specifications
· Supported formats: Dolby Digital, Pro Logic II, & PCM
· Inputs: (1) SPDIF optical & (1) coaxial input
· Outputs: Left-Right RCA analog stereo outputs
· Weight: 3.5 ounces (~100g)
· Dimensions: 1.8" x 1.8" x 0.9" (46 x 46 x 23 mm)
· Power: 5V PSU included
